有大牛知道 android 源码中的 framework 层 native 方法对应的 C/C++ 代码哪里找

2018-01-04 16:36:24 +08:00
 guchengyehai1

调试程序的时候经常在 native 层就调不下去了, 想知道怎样找到这部分的代码看看实际的逻辑

2084 次点击
所在节点    问与答
6 条回复
ReysC
2018-01-04 17:44:39 +08:00
看对应的 JNI 文件。
guchengyehai1
2018-01-04 17:47:16 +08:00
@ReysC 问题是 jni 文件都不知道在哪儿,比较难找到
ReysC
2018-01-04 18:05:51 +08:00
查 java 的类名,一般都是前面加个 I,或者后面改为 Service
bleaker
2018-01-04 18:38:06 +08:00
snowspace
2018-01-04 21:45:30 +08:00
guchengyehai1
2018-01-05 10:20:57 +08:00
@ReysC 好办法,的确如此

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/420080

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X